CPI Housing Utilities in the United States averaged 148.56 … WebJan 12, 2024 · The CPI market basket does not include the cost of housing units because spending to purchase and improve housing is investment, not consumption. However, the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) does use its survey of consumers to collect and calculate the cost of shelter, which is the service that housing units provide.
